Sidebets — 聊天里的预测游戏 (Monad + Telegram Bot + x402)Sidebets 是一个极轻量预测游戏:只需在 Telegram 群里输入 /newbet,朋友们就能点击 YES/NO 按钮下注,管理员裁决后由 Monad 合约自动派彩。不需要网页、不需要 KYC。预测内容可以是“今晚聚会谁会迟到”,也可以是“BTC 2025年能否重回10w”telegram聊天发一句话,就是一个完整的链上预测市场。backend + 合约部分已经部署backend API 见于 sidebets-x402/backend/BACKEND_README.mdhttps://tg-side-bet.vercel.app 为backend 域名tg bot没有演示地址 botName: @tgSideBet_bot🎯 基础场景(当前 MVP 已实现)1. 创建赌局在 Telegram 群里输入:/newbet 小王今天会迟到吗?|1735727400
Bot 会生成下注按钮:[ YES ] [ NO ]
2. 下注朋友们点击 YES/NO,即可下注小额原生代币(1–5 MON)。下注信息写入 Monad 合约的对应池子(YES/NO)。3. 裁决到达截止时间后,管理员输入:/resolve_yes <betId>
合约进入 Resolved 状态,计算彩池。4. 领奖赢家输入:/claim <betId>
合约根据下注比例自动派彩。整个逻辑完全链上透明、无需 UI。🚀 扩展场景(未来版本)1. KOL + Followers 预测市场KOL 在群里发起预测:“我预测 BTC 会在午夜前突破 60k。”粉丝点击 YES/NO 押注。KOL 的预测可以影响彩池分布,也可以获得社交收益(fee / 社交权重)。2. 预言机自动判定结果(无须管理员)支持自动化事件判断,例如:BTC 是否突破某价位今天是否下雨(天气预言机)某只股票是否涨跌超过 X%某条推文是否超过目标 likes 数合约可通过预言机喂价自动结算。3. 多人投票裁决(适合主观结果)对于有争议的事件,允许所有参与者投票:若投票结果一致 → 派彩若分歧很大 → 退回本金可加入 Kleros / 乐观投票机制4. 更丰富的玩法多选预测(A/B/C/D)连胜奖励 / 排行榜Sidebets 作为其他 App 的预测 SDK投注金额生息(大型赌局可进入利息池)⚡ x402 在 Sidebets 中的作用目前 MVP 使用“backend 钱包代为下注”的模式以提升开发速度。未来将通过 x402 实现:1. 用户真实支付下注(无钱包、无 KYC)流程:用户点击下注按钮后端返回 402 Payment Required用户在钱包中完成 x402 支付(USDC 或其他资产)后端确认支付成功代用户调用 placeBetFor → 把下注金额写入链上无需用户持有链上私钥,极大降低使用门槛。2. 允许 Agent 自动下注因为 x402 是“链下支付 + 链上代办”,Agent 可以自动下注:Agent 发现机会 → x402 支付 → 后端下注 → 合约入池
这使 Sidebets 成为「Agent 原生」的预测基础设施。3. 资金更安全、更合规x402 提供明确的支付身份与收据后端/Relayer 负责将资产转换成合约所需的 token/nativeSidebets 合约始终作为资金的最终托管方🌟一句话总结Sidebets 将“聊天”变成“链上预测市场入口”,让预测不再需要 UI 或钱包。Monad 提供可负担的高频交易性能,x402 进一步降低支付门槛,为 KOL 场景、自动化 Agent 预测、模块化 DeFi 预测协议打开无限可能。